首頁 新聞動態(tài) 程序開發(fā) 網(wǎng)站程序開發(fā)中的網(wǎng)站重構(gòu)與代碼優(yōu)化

網(wǎng)站程序開發(fā)中的網(wǎng)站重構(gòu)與代碼優(yōu)化

來源:網(wǎng)站建設(shè) | 時間:2024-05-02 | 瀏覽:

網(wǎng)站程序開發(fā)中的網(wǎng)站重構(gòu)與代碼優(yōu)化

隨著互聯(lián)網(wǎng)的不斷發(fā)展,網(wǎng)站在人們的生活中扮演著越來越重要的角色。作為一個網(wǎng)站的核心,網(wǎng)站程序開發(fā)需要不斷進行維護和優(yōu)化,以確保網(wǎng)站的正常運行和用戶體驗。在這個過程中,網(wǎng)站重構(gòu)和代碼優(yōu)化成為了必不可少的環(huán)節(jié)。本文將詳細討論網(wǎng)站重構(gòu)和代碼優(yōu)化的重要性,以及如何進行有效的改進。

網(wǎng)站重構(gòu)是指對已有的網(wǎng)站進行結(jié)構(gòu)和設(shè)計的調(diào)整,從而提升網(wǎng)站的性能、可維護性和可擴展性。網(wǎng)站重構(gòu)的目的是讓網(wǎng)站更加符合用戶的需求,并且保持可持續(xù)發(fā)展。在進行網(wǎng)站重構(gòu)時,有幾個關(guān)鍵因素需要考慮。

需要明確網(wǎng)站的目標和定位。了解網(wǎng)站的目標用戶群體,以及用戶的需求和偏好,是進行網(wǎng)站重構(gòu)的重要前提。只有通過了解用戶的需求,才能進行有針對性的網(wǎng)站調(diào)整,提升用戶體驗。

需要對網(wǎng)站的結(jié)構(gòu)進行合理規(guī)劃。一個良好的網(wǎng)站結(jié)構(gòu)能夠提高網(wǎng)站的可讀性和導(dǎo)航性,使用戶更容易找到自己需要的信息。合理規(guī)劃網(wǎng)站的目錄結(jié)構(gòu)、頁面布局和導(dǎo)航鏈接,能夠減少用戶在網(wǎng)站中的迷茫感,提升用戶留存率。

網(wǎng)站的頁面加載速度也是進行網(wǎng)站重構(gòu)的一個重要方面。用戶對網(wǎng)頁的加載速度非常敏感,如果網(wǎng)站加載過慢,用戶很可能會選擇離開。通過優(yōu)化網(wǎng)站的代碼和資源加載方式,可以有效提高網(wǎng)站的加載速度。例如,使用壓縮和合并CSS和JavaScript文件,優(yōu)化圖片大小和格式,減少HTTP請求等方式,都可以降低網(wǎng)站的加載時間,提升用戶的體驗。

代碼優(yōu)化是網(wǎng)站開發(fā)中的另一個關(guān)鍵環(huán)節(jié)。代碼優(yōu)化旨在提高網(wǎng)站的性能和可維護性,減少不必要的資源占用。在進行代碼優(yōu)化時,可以從以下幾個方面入手。

需要對網(wǎng)站的代碼進行合理的組織和結(jié)構(gòu)。通過模塊化開發(fā)和使用設(shè)計模式,可以降低代碼的耦合性,提高代碼的可讀性和可維護性。將代碼分解為獨立的功能模塊,使得代碼邏輯更加清晰明了。

需要注意代碼的復(fù)用性。通過封裝通用的代碼塊和函數(shù),可以減少代碼的冗余,提高代碼的重用率。這樣不僅可以減少開發(fā)工作量,還可以提高代碼的穩(wěn)定性和可靠性。

代碼的優(yōu)化也需要考慮數(shù)據(jù)庫的性能。合理設(shè)計和優(yōu)化數(shù)據(jù)庫的表結(jié)構(gòu)、索引和查詢語句,能夠提高網(wǎng)站的數(shù)據(jù)處理速度,減少數(shù)據(jù)庫的負載。

代碼的可測試性也是代碼優(yōu)化的一個重要方面。通過編寫可重復(fù)測試的代碼,可以及早發(fā)現(xiàn)和解決潛在的問題,確保網(wǎng)站的穩(wěn)定性和可靠性。

在網(wǎng)站程序開發(fā)中,網(wǎng)站重構(gòu)和代碼優(yōu)化是提升網(wǎng)站性能和用戶體驗的重要手段。通過合理的網(wǎng)站結(jié)構(gòu)規(guī)劃和頁面加載速度的優(yōu)化,能夠提高用戶留存率和轉(zhuǎn)化率。通過代碼的組織和優(yōu)化,能夠提高網(wǎng)站的可讀性、可維護性和可測試性。因此,在進行網(wǎng)站開發(fā)時,不僅要注重功能的實現(xiàn),還要關(guān)注網(wǎng)站的結(jié)構(gòu)和代碼的質(zhì)量,從而打造出更好的用戶體驗。

更多和”代碼優(yōu)化“相關(guān)的文章

TAG:網(wǎng)站重構(gòu)代碼優(yōu)化用戶體驗網(wǎng)站結(jié)構(gòu)頁面加載速度可維護性可測試性數(shù)據(jù)庫性能
在線咨詢
服務(wù)熱線
服務(wù)熱線:400-888-9358
TOP